The St. Ignatius Falcons are off to a hot start in senior girls high school basketball.
The Falcons rode a dozen points from MeganYuan, easily getting past Churchill 31-19 on Thursday to improve to 2-0. Laura Holten and Steph Drost scored six apiece in a losing cause.
Not to be outdone, Hammarskjold blasted Westgate 44-8 to also improve to 2-0. The Vikings have outscored their opponents 80-19 in two games.
On the junior girls court, the Vikings were just as ruthless, running away from Westgate 50-12. Shannon McKirtrick led the way with 13 points for 2-0 Hammarskjold. Westgate fell to 0-2.
Elsewhere Katelyn Parabocchia netted eight points as Superior Collegiate downed St. Patrick 31-24.
In senior boys volleyball play St. Patrick swept Superior , Westgate beat Hammarskjold and St. Ignatius rolled past Churchill by identical 3-0 scores.
On the junior boys side, St. Patrick swept Superior, while Churchill edged St. Ignatius 2-1 and Hammarskjold beat Westgate 2-1.
In the high school boys golf playoff quarterfinals, St. Ignatius beat La Verendrye by default and will take on Hammarskjold in the next round. The third-seed Vikings swept St. Patrick 3-0.
